As a LOB Risk Lead – Retail Basel Capital, you will be you will be within PNC’s Risk, Change, Experience & Strategy (RCES) organization, supporting the Capital Management Team.This position will be responsible for the performance of Basel regulatory capital requirements for the retail asset class. Primary responsibilities will include data analysis, quarterly reporting, certification support, control performance, data quality, and program documentation. Successful candidates will be expected to utilize data techniques to perform analysis to ensure appropriate categorization, evaluate results, and articulate impacts. The candidate will also lead the recovery & resolution planning program for Retail Banking, including data collection, analysis, certification process, and coordination of multiple workstreams to achieve regulatory requirements. This role partners primarily with finance, lines of business, merger & acquisition team, and data governance. Preferred qualifications of the position include but are not limited to the following:
• Strong understanding of Retail Banking business segments, processes, and products
• Ability to extract, manipulate, and present data analysis (strong Excel skills at minimum)
• Foundational knowledge of internal Retail Banking source systems capturing credit data elements and financial reporting tools
• Understanding of bank financial statements, banking products, credit risk, and financial analysis
• Experience managing multiple/complex projects
• Regulatory reporting experience a plus
